According to China Nuclear Power Engineering Co., Ltd., the self-developed spent fuel tank liquid level temperature measuring device independently researched and developed by Chengdu Zhongxin Xinxing Applied Technology Research Institute successfully passed the inspection and achieved an important breakthrough in the localization of nuclear power instrumentation in China. Approved in Fuqing Unit 34 using nuclear Xin Star independent research and development of spent fuel pool temperature measuring device in the recent successful completion of the factory test, adopted by the China Nuclear Power Engineering Co., Ltd. Purchasing Department, together with the electrical instrument Acceptance work. The spent fuel tank level temperature measuring device is a device for measuring the real-time level and temperature of the spent fuel pool.
